| Connection URL | ldap://your.domain.net orldap://your.domain.net:nnn |
Identifies the URL (your.domain.net) for the LDAP server. Standard LDAP ports are 389, or 636 (if using SSL). If the server uses a non-standard port, include
the port (your.domain.net:nnn) in the URL, for example, ldap://your.domain.net.999.
|

| User Login Attr | textFor AD this value defaults to sAMAccountName |
Identifies the specific attribute in the LDAP directory to store the LDAP user login name. For AD servers, this is always
sAMAccountName. For OpenLDAP servers, it would be uid.
|
| User Base | domain components |
Identifies the sub-tree of the LDAP server in which users who can access this station are found. At the very least it must
contain the domain components of the server’s domain, for example: DC=domain, CD=net.
|

| Cache Expiration | date and time |
Defines a future date after which the system no longer stores a user’s password in cache. When an LDAP server is unavailable
a user can still log on with the cached credentials until this date and time.
This property applies to Kerberos authentication even though the station never receives the user’s password. Instead, the station verifies the corresponding Kerberos user ticket against the cached user information. |
| Connection Timeout | time |
Determines the length of time the station attempts to connect to the LDAP server before the connection fails.
The station will not fail over to the next LDAP server until the first connection attempt is unresponsive for the amount of time specified in the connection timeout. This time should not be too short to cause false connection failures, but not so long as to cause excessive delays when a server is down. |

| Connection User | text |
Defines the user name for the initial LDAP server connection. It may be required if users, who will be logging in, are in
different sub-trees of the LDAP directory. If the LDAP server supports anonymous connections, leave this property empty (blank).
When used, requires a valid user name in the LDAP server. The system uses this name to connect to the server for authentication.
|
